Recently, I had an in-depth experience with Dusk, a blockchain focused on compliant finance. As a developer, I can describe the feeling as "comfortable."
First of all, the entire development experience is very friendly. The documentation is detailed, the toolchain configuration is reasonable, and there are basically no awkward gaps. This can save a lot of trouble for teams eager to push their project forward.
The biggest difference lies in privacy protection. Many public chains require developers to adapt and combine various privacy solutions, which is time-consuming and prone to bugs. Dusk directly integrates a native privacy layer, ready to use out of the box. This means you can focus more on business logic rather than delving into compliance details.
Auditability is also a plug-and-play feature. This is crucial for institutional users or applications that require regular audits. Meeting regulatory reporting requirements is no longer an additional technical burden.
The architecture adopts a modular design, giving developers great flexibility in composition. You can assemble functional modules like building blocks based on actual needs. This level of freedom is rare on other public chains.
The ecosystem is also making efforts. Real-world asset tokenization projects have found a solid infrastructure here. Partners regularly organize technical seminars, and there are targeted funding programs—not just verbal support.
The community has a strong developer atmosphere, with everyone eager to share experiences and lessons learned. This peer-to-peer knowledge exchange is often more valuable than official documentation.
For teams interested in compliant DeFi or RWA projects, Dusk helps you avoid many detours in risk and compliance. The entire tech stack is designed for this purpose, requiring no extra fuss.
